Founding
Founders include Gil Shwed[9], Shlomo Kramer[10], and Marius Nacht[11]. +1993-00-00T00:00:00Z marks the founding of Check Point[25]. Its location of formation is recorded as Ramat Gan[27].

Ownership
Owners include Gil Shwed[12], a programmer[31], b. 1968[32], of Israel[33], awarded the honorary doctorate[34] and Marius Nacht[13], an engineer[35], b. 1962[36], of Israel[37]. Check Point's stock exchange is recorded as Nasdaq[23]. Products include networking hardware[38] and software[39].
